Does Your Pup Scratching Continuously?

Seeing your furry friend constantly itching can be a heartbreaker. But before you reach for the harsh chemicals, consider these natural options to soothe their skin. Coconut oil, known for its anti-inflammatory properties, can work wonders on itchy areas. Another great choice is a cool bath with oatmeal, which helps to reduce irritation.

Stop Scratching in Dogs

Is your furry pal itching nonstop? Dog itches can be a real pain for both you and your pup. Luckily, there are some fast and effective remedies to bring relief. First, try bathing your dog with a special anti-itch shampoo. After the bath, gently apply a hypoallergenic cream on the itchy areas. Ensure your dog's environment clean and free of allergens.
